Orange Cameroun has announced a new career opportunity for experienced IT professionals through its Orange Cameroun Recruitment 2026 campaign. The company is seeking to recruit a Chef de Département RUN IT to join its operations in Douala, Cameroon.

This senior leadership role is ideal for professionals with extensive experience in IT infrastructure, systems administration, cloud technologies, databases, and telecommunications. The successful candidate will lead operational IT teams while ensuring the availability, security, and performance of critical business systems.

About the Position

The Chef de Département RUN IT will oversee the operational management of Orange Cameroun’s information systems. The role focuses on maintaining reliable IT services, improving operational efficiency, supporting digital transformation initiatives, and ensuring continuous service delivery across the organization.

The selected candidate will also coordinate production deployments, supervise IT operations, optimize operational costs, and contribute to technology innovation.

Required Qualifications

Applicants should possess:

  • A Master’s degree (Bac+5) in Computer Engineering, Information Technology, or Telecommunications.
  • At least seven years of professional experience in IT infrastructure, systems, databases, or enterprise applications.
  • A minimum of four years of managerial experience leading IT operations or major technology projects.

Technical Skills Required

Orange Cameroun is looking for candidates with strong expertise in:

  • IT infrastructure management
  • Microsoft and RedHat operating systems
  • Cloud computing (Private and Public Cloud)
  • Oracle, MySQL, MariaDB, and SQL Server databases
  •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P)
  • Customer Relationship Management (CRM)
  • Telecom billing and provisioning platforms
  • Mobile Money ecosystems
  • API management
  • Incident, problem, and change management
  • Storage, backup, and archiving solutions
  • Budget planning and operational performance optimization

Professional certifications such as ITIL or COBIT are highly desirable.
